There is no doubt that the judicial ruling when issued is still valid and provoked to provoke the law. When a judge decides on a particular matter and separates it, he thereby exhausts the power of the authority vested in him on that matter. He may not revoke what has been done, or reconsider the previous ruling even if His judgment was invalid.
